A Deck Built for a Barrier Island, Not Just a Backyard

Redington Beach sits right on the Gulf, and that changes what a deck actually needs to survive out here. A deck built the same way you'd build one twenty miles inland in Largo or further into Pinellas County will age differently — usually faster, and usually in ways that aren't obvious until fasteners start bleeding rust or boards start cupping at the edges. Building a deck for a barrier island property means starting from the exposure, not from a catalog of decking colors.

What This Stretch of Coast Demands From a Deck

Every part of a deck's design and construction gets tested harder here than in most of the country. Four conditions in particular drive almost every decision we make on a Redington Beach deck.

Salt Air and Corrosion

Salt-laden air moving off the Gulf accelerates corrosion in anything metal — fasteners, joist hangers, post bases, railing hardware. Standard hot-dip galvanized fasteners that hold up fine inland can start showing surface rust within a few seasons this close to the water. Once a fastener corrodes, it loses holding strength long before it looks obviously bad, which matters more on a structure that's holding people up than almost anywhere else on a house.

Intense, Nearly Year-Round UV

Florida's sun exposure is among the most intense in the country, and on a barrier island there's rarely much shade to soften it. UV breaks down unprotected wood fibers, fades and chalks finishes, and dries out sealants faster than in a milder climate. Decking material and finish choices that aren't rated for this level of sun exposure show it within a season or two — graying, splintering, or finish failure well ahead of schedule.

Hurricane-Force Wind

A deck is a structure, and in this part of Florida it has to be engineered to resist real uplift and lateral load, not just support the weight of furniture and people standing on it. Ledger attachment, post-to-beam connections, and railing anchoring all need to be built to current Florida Building Code wind requirements, and that matters more directly on a barrier island where wind exposure is higher than on a comparable inland lot.

Wind-Driven Rain at the House Connection

Where a deck attaches to the house — the ledger board — is one of the most common places water finds its way into a wall that was never designed to get wet there. Wind-driven rain pushes water sideways and upward into gaps that straight-down rain would never reach, and a ledger that isn't flashed correctly can quietly feed moisture into the house framing for years before anyone notices a problem.

Choosing a Decking Material for This Exposure

There's no single "best" decking material for every budget and every homeowner, but there is a clear set of trade-offs once you factor in salt air, sun, and moisture cycling. Here's how the common options actually behave in this environment.

MaterialHow It Handles This ClimateMaintenanceTypical Lifespan Here
Pressure-treated pineAbsorbs and releases moisture readily; can cup, check, or splinter with repeated wet-to-sun cyclingRegular sealing/staining, roughly every 1-2 years in this UV loadShorter end of the range without diligent upkeep
Tropical hardwood (ipe and similar)Naturally dense and rot-resistant; still needs oiling to hold color and prevent surface checking under intense sunPeriodic oiling to maintain appearance; structurally low-maintenanceLong, if maintained; among the more expensive options up front
Wood-plastic composite deckingDoesn't absorb water the way solid wood does, but early-generation composites could fade or mildew; modern capped composites resist this betterOccasional washing; no staining or sealingLong, with less upkeep than wood
Capped PVC deckingFully synthetic cap resists moisture absorption, salt exposure, and UV fading better than any wood-based optionLowest maintenance of the group — washing onlyLong, with the most consistent appearance over time near saltwater

What we install comes down to what a homeowner wants to maintain and what they're willing to spend up front. A composite or capped PVC deck costs more at installation but asks almost nothing of you afterward. A wood deck costs less initially but only holds up if someone keeps up with sealing and refinishing on a real schedule — something that's easy to fall behind on once the newness wears off.

What a Correctly Built Deck Involves Below the Surface

Decking material is the part everyone sees. The structure underneath it is what actually determines whether the deck is safe and how long it lasts, and it's where corners get cut on underbid jobs.

Footings and Structural Connections

Footings need to be sized and set to the depth and bearing capacity the site and code require, not a generic minimum. Post-to-beam and beam-to-ledger connections should use rated structural hardware — hurricane ties, structural screws, and connectors sized for the actual wind load a barrier island property will see, not just what's convenient to install.

Ledger Flashing

Where the deck ledger attaches to the house, correct flashing directs water outward and away from the wall rather than letting it collect against the band joist. This is one of the least visible details on a finished deck and one of the most consequential if it's skipped or rushed, especially with wind-driven rain hitting that connection point from the Gulf side.

Fasteners and Hardware

Every fastener and connector on a coastal deck should be rated for a marine or coastal environment — stainless steel or coated fasteners specifically suited to salt exposure, not the standard-grade hardware that's fine on an inland build. This is a small line item on a quote and one of the first things that fails prematurely when it's skipped.

Permitting and Code Considerations Near the Water

Deck construction anywhere in Pinellas County requires a permit and has to meet current Florida Building Code wind load requirements, and barrier island communities like Redington Beach often layer on their own local building department review on top of that. Waterfront and near-waterfront properties can also fall under FEMA flood zone rules that affect things like elevation and how a structure attached to the house is allowed to be built. None of this is a reason to skip permitting — it's a reason to work with a crew that already knows which jurisdiction's process applies to a given property and pulls the permit correctly the first time, rather than guessing and hoping it passes inspection.

Maintaining a Coastal Deck Once It's Built

Even a well-built deck needs some ongoing attention in this environment, and what that attention looks like depends heavily on the material chosen.

  • Rinse salt residue off the deck surface and hardware periodically, especially after storms
  • Inspect fasteners, railing connections, and ledger flashing at least once a year for early corrosion or gaps
  • Reseal or restain wood decking on a real schedule rather than waiting until it visibly needs it
  • Keep drainage paths under and around the deck clear so water isn't sitting against footings or framing
  • Address any loose boards, popped fasteners, or soft spots right away rather than waiting for the next season

How long should a well-built deck actually last in a coastal Florida environment like this?

With the right materials and correct structural detailing, a deck in this environment can reasonably last two to three decades or more, though the decking surface itself may need attention or replacement sooner depending on the material. Salt air, UV, and wind-driven rain shorten the lifespan of anything built to a generic inland standard, which is why material choice and hardware grade matter more here than in most parts of the country. The structural frame, if built and flashed correctly, is usually the longest-lived part of the system.

Is composite or PVC decking actually worth the higher upfront cost compared to wood?

For most homeowners in this environment, yes, because the maintenance savings and resistance to salt and UV damage add up over the years you'd otherwise spend sealing and repairing wood. Wood decking, including tropical hardwoods, can still be a good choice if you're willing to keep up with regular oiling or sealing on schedule. It comes down to whether you'd rather pay more up front or spend ongoing time and money maintaining the surface.

Why do fasteners and hardware matter so much on a deck this close to the Gulf?

Salt-laden air accelerates corrosion in standard fasteners and connectors far faster than it would inland, and a corroding fastener loses holding strength well before it looks visibly bad. On a structure that's supporting people's weight, that's not a cosmetic issue — it's a safety issue over time. Coastal-rated stainless steel or specifically coated hardware is a small cost difference that has an outsized effect on how long the structure stays sound.

Are there special permitting or flood zone rules for building a deck in a barrier island community like Redington Beach?

Barrier island communities often have their own local building department requirements layered on top of Pinellas County and Florida Building Code rules, and waterfront properties can fall under FEMA flood zone regulations that affect elevation and how a deck attaches to the house. The right permitting path depends on the specific property and jurisdiction, which is why it's worth working with a crew that already knows which process applies rather than finding out mid-project. Skipping or guessing at permitting on a coastal property is a common way projects stall at inspection.
